Greetings,

Is it possible to run 2 instances of a WebWiz forum on 1 host?

More specifically:
2 different databases with different names each pointing to their
specific directory.
2 different forum directories each having a different name like
forum and forum2. ( common.asp points to database )

Now, I know how to point the common.asp files to the database.

Do I need to point the database to the specific forum directory if it is renamed, or is all of that taken care of by the .asp?

You can run two copies on the same host.

However, as web wiz forums uses application variables, if the two forums are running on the same domain sharing application variables, then you will need to disable the use of application variables by editing the common.asp file and also turn off active users features from the admin area.

If you are running the two forums in different domains or sub domains they should have their own application level variables so you won't need to do this.

If you change the name and location of the database you simply need to follow the install instructions on how to change the path and name reference in the common.asp files:-
